Company overview

Mahindra EPC Irrigation Limited specializes in producing and distributing micro-irrigation solutions across India. Their extensive range of drip irrigation offerings includes both online systems, such as drippers and basic lateral pipes, and various inline drip products like non-pressure compensating cylindrical, pressure compensating cylindrical, flat, pressure compensating flat, and thin-wall flat inline types. They also supply crucial components for these systems, including hydrocyclone, sand, screen, and disc filters, as well as header assemblies. For sprinkler irrigation, they provide sprinkler heads, rapid coupling pipes, and rain guns. The company further offers a selection of pumps, encompassing submersible models for bore wells, monoblock setups, and open wells. In addition, their product portfolio extends to high-density polyethylene (HDPE) pipes and coils, alongside landscape and turf irrigation equipment like valves, nozzles, rotors, and spray bodies. They also produce specialized piping designed for water conveyance and gas distribution networks. Beyond physical products, the firm provides valuable agronomic support and advisory services for crop cultivation and farm management. While primarily serving the domestic Indian market, Mahindra EPC also exports its offerings internationally. Established in 1981 and based in Nashik, India, the enterprise adopted its current name, Mahindra EPC Irrigation Limited, in February 2019, having previously been known as EPC Industrie Limited. It functions as a subsidiary of Mahindra and Mahindra Limited.
